Solar Panels Installation in Milford, CT
Solar panel installation services in Milford, CT, enable property owners to harness solar energy efficiently. Professionals evaluate sites, design systems, and handle permits to ensure seamless setup of rooftop and ground-mounted solar solutions. These services help reduce energy costs and promote sustainability for residential and commercial properties alike.